Please note that the content of this book primarily consists of articles available from Wikipedia or other free sources online.The Singapore legislative assembly general election of 1963 was an election that took place in Singapore on 21 September 1963 following five days after the merger with Malaysia and therefore as an autonomous state of Malaysia. Based on results from a poll of Singapore citizens from their respective constituencies, the elections decided how to allocate the total of 51 seats for the Legislative Assembly of Singapore, the predecessor to the Parliament of Singapore, to nominated candidates. The ruling People''s Action Party kept its refreshed mandate as it won 37 out of the 51 seats, the Barisan Sosialis 13 and the United People''s Party 1. The 1963 elections are also known for being the elections where the United Malays National Organisation (UMNO), the ruling party of the Central Government in Malaysia tried to oust the People''s Action Party by sending in the UMNO-backed Singapore Alliance Party to contest the elections, violating previous agreement not to do so and a highlight in the relations between UMNO and the PAP.
